TcpTransportSecurity Klasse
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t Eigenschaften bereit, die die Authentifizierungsparameter und die Schutzebene für den TCP-Transport steuern.
public ref class TcpTransportSecurity sealed
public sealed class TcpTransportSecurity
type TcpTransportSecurity = class
Public NotInheritable Class TcpTransportSecurity
- Vererbung
-
TcpTransportSecurity
Diese Klasse wird von Transport verwendet, um die Sicherheitseinstellungen für eine Bindung auf Transportebene festzulegen.
Tcp |
Initialisiert eine neue Instanz der TcpTransportSecurity-Klasse. |
Client |
Ruft den Typ der Clientanmeldeinformationen ab, der zur Authentifizierung verwendet wird, oder legt diesen fest. |
Extended |
Ruft die erweiterte Schutzrichtlinie für den TCP-Transport ab oder legt diese fest. |
Protection |
Ruft die ProtectionLevel für den TCP-Stream ab oder legt diese fest. |
Ssl |
Gibt die Liste der bei Verwendung des Client-Anmeldeinformationstyps "TcpClientCredentialType.Certificate" auszuhandelnden SSL/TLS-Protokolle an. Der Wert kann eine Kombination aus einem oder mehreren der folgenden Enumerationsmember sein: Ssl3, Tls, Tls11, Tls12. |
Equals(Object) |
Bestimmt, ob das angegebene Objekt gleich dem aktuellen Objekt ist. (Geerbt von Object) |
Get |
Fungiert als Standardhashfunktion. (Geerbt von Object) |
Get |
Ruft den Type der aktuellen Instanz ab. (Geerbt von Object) |
Memberwise |
Erstellt eine flache Kopie des aktuellen Object. (Geerbt von Object) |
Should |
Gibt einen Wert zurück, der angibt, ob die ExtendedProtectionPolicy-Eigenschaft ihren Standardwert geändert hat und serialisiert werden soll. Dieser wird von WCF für die XAML-Integration verwendet. |
To |
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Geerbt von Object) |
Produkt | Versionen |
---|---|
.NET | Core 1.0, Core 1.1, 8 (package-provided), 9 (package-provided), 10 (package-provided) |
.NET Framework | 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1 |
.NET Standard | 2.0 (package-provided) |
UWP | 10.0 |
Feedback zu .NET
.NET ist ein Open Source-Projekt. Wählen Sie einen Link aus, um Feedback zu geben: